What Is The Difference Between Bone-in And Boneless Chicken Breast?
Boneless chicken breast is chicken breast meat that has been skinned, deboned, and sliced into thin pieces. Boneless chicken breast is often used in stir-fries, casseroles, and salads.
Bone-in chicken breast is chicken breast meat that still has the bone attached. Bone-in chicken breast is often used in roasting and grilling.
Both boneless and bone-in chicken breast are healthy options, but boneless chicken breast tends to be lower in fat and calories. Bone-in chicken breast has more flavor, but it may be harder to eat.
So, which one should you choose? It depends on your preference and the recipe you are making. If you are making a stir-fry or a salad, boneless chicken breast is a good choice. If you are roasting or grilling, bone-in chicken breast is a good choice.

What Are The Best Ways To Cook Boneless Chicken Breast?
Boneless chicken breast is a versatile and lean protein option that can be cooked in various ways. Here are some of the best ways to cook boneless chicken breast:
1. Baking: Baking is a healthy and simple method to cook boneless chicken breast. Preheat the o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it, place the chicken breasts in a baking dish, and season them with salt and pepper or other spices. Drizzle some olive oil or melted butter over the chicken and bake for about 20-25 minutes, or until the internal temperature of the chicken reaches 165 degrees Fahrenheit.
2. Pan-frying: Pan-frying is a quick and easy method to cook boneless chicken breast. Heat some oil in a pan over medium-high heat, add the chicken breasts, and cook for about 4-5 minutes per side, or until the chicken is golden brown and the internal temperature reaches 165 degrees Fahrenheit. Season the chicken with salt and pepper or other spices before pan-frying.
3. Grilling: Grilling is a great way to cook boneless chicken breast, especially during the summer. Preheat the grill to medium-high heat, brush the chicken with oil or melted butter, and season it with salt and pepper or other spices. Grill the chicken for about 5-6 minutes per side, or until the internal temperature reaches 165 degrees Fahrenheit.
